Gather Your Ingredients

Before stepping foot in the kitchen, it’s essential to assemble all your ingredients. This not only saves time but keeps your workflow smooth.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• 3 ripe bananas (the riper, the better!)
  • 1/3 cup melted butter (unsalted is preferred)
  • 1/2 cup sugar (adjust to taste; brown sugar adds a lovely depth)
  • 1 large egg (at room temperature)
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• Pinch of salt
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up chocolate chips (dark or semi-sweet work best)

These ingredients create the perfect balance of flavors. To understand more about why ripe bananas are crucial for your muffins, check out this insightful article on banana ripeness.

Mix the Dry Ingredients

Now that you have everything prepped, it’s time to focus on the dry ingredients. In a medium bowl, mix together the flour, baking soda, and salt. Whisking these together ensures that the baking soda is evenly distributed, which helps your muffins rise beautifully.

You might wonder, “Why is weighing and measuring important?” Proper measurements can greatly impact the consistency and taste of the muffins. It’s the little details that count!

Combine the Wet Ingredients

In a separate large bowl, mash those ripe bananas with a fork until they’re mostly smooth but still have a few small lumps. Add in the melted butter (let it cool a bit first to avoid cooking the egg), followed by the sugar, egg, and vanilla extract. Mix them together until well combined. This step is crucial because it infuses sweetness and keeps your muffins moist.

Are you wondering why we use butter instead of oil? Butter provides a richer flavor and a sumptuous texture that oil just can’t match.

Fold in the Banana and Chocolate Chips

Once your wet ingredients are well mixed, it’s time to integrate the dry ingredients. Add the flour mixture into the bowl of wet ingredients in three parts, stirring gently until just combined. Be cautious—overmixing can lead to tough muffins!

Now comes the exciting part: fold in the chocolate chips. This is where you can let your creativity shine! Consider adding in chopped nuts or a swirl of peanut butter or Nutella for an extra twist. Imagine the gooey melted chocolate contrasting with the sweet banana—heavenly!

Fill the Muffin Tins

Preheat your oven to 350°F (about 175°C) while you scoop the batter into muffin tins lined with cupcake liners or greased with a bit of non-stick spray. Fill each cup about 2/3 full to allow for rising. A handy tip: using an ice cream scoop makes this job super easy and mess-free.

Bake to Perfection

Now it’s time to bake your masterpieces! Place the muffin tin in the preheated oven and let those chocolate chip banana muffins bake for about 18–22 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Your kitchen will be filled with an inviting smell that’ll make it hard to resist!

Once they’re done, allow the muffins to cool in the tin for about 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ack. This helps them maintain their moisture and texture.

Baking Tips for Chocolate Chip Banana Muffins

Baking chocolate chip banana muffins is a delightful way to use up overripe bananas! Here are some friendly tips to ensure your muffins turn out perfectly every time.

Choose Ripe Bananas

For the best flavor, opt for bananas that are heavily speckled or even black. The riper they are, the sweeter and more flavorful your muffins will become.

Measure Ingredients Accurately

Precision matters in baking! Use a kitchen scale or measuring cups to accurately measure your flour and brown sugar. This helps maintain that ideal texture — you want your muffins to be light and fluffy, not dense.

Don’t Overmix the Batter

Scared of lumpy batter? Don’t be! Gently fold in the dry ingredients until just combined. Overmixing can result in tough muffins. You want those chocolate chips to shine without being overshadowed by the overly worked batter.

Opt for High-Quality Chocolate Chips

Your muffins deserve the best! Using high-quality chocolate chips can truly elevate the flavor. It’s worth investing a little extra for a more indulgent treat.

Test for Doneness

Use a toothpick! Insert it into the center of a muffin; if it comes out clean (or with just a few crumbs), they’re done. Always err on the side of underbaking slightly for that soft, moist texture.

Chocolate Chip Banana Muffins: The Best Easy Recipe Ever

Deliciously moist chocolate chip banana muffins that are easy to make and perfect for any occasion.

  • Author: Souzan
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 12 muffins 1x
  • Category: Desserts
  • Method: Baking
  • Cuisine: American
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Ingredients

Scale
  • 3 ripe bananas
  • 1/3 cup melted butter
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• Pinch of salt
  • 3/4 cup s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up chocolate chips

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a mixing bowl, mash the ripe bananas with a fork until smooth.
  3. Mix in the melted butter.
  4. Stir in baking soda and salt.
  5. Add the sugar, egg, and vanilla extract; mix until combined.
  6. Gradually add the flour and mix until just combined.
  7. Fold in chocolate chips.
  8. Pour the batter into a greased muffin tin.
  9. Bake for 18-20 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
  10. Let cool for a few minutes before serving.
